1. The Core Infrastructure: IBM Power11 with MMA
The IBM Power11 chip is designed for massive enterprise and military-grade workloads, but its real secret weapon is the Matrix Multiply Assist (MMA).
The Value: MMA provides hardware-accelerated, built-in AI inferencing and mathematical matrix computation directly on the processor without requiring external, power-hungry, and supply-chain-vulnerable GPUs.
Golden Dome Impact: For an air and missile defense shield operating at lightning-fast speeds, extracting and processing data across tens of thousands of sensor feeds requires local, edge-capable, low-latency AI computing. The Power11 MMA provides this while maintaining strict on-premise security and high cyber resilience.

4. Cyberspatial: Mapping the Mission-Relevant Terrain
Cyberspatial specializes in mapping out physical and digital infrastructure ("mission-relevant terrain") into comprehensive geospatial and cyber-terrain blueprints.
The Value: Cyberspatial takes complex digital architecture—like the network topologies of Golden Dome's command-and-control systems—and maps them visually and topologically so commanders can see where threats live.
Golden Dome Impact: By combining Cyberspatial’s terrain mapping with Equitus's knowledge graph and Rocketgraph's fast querying, the Golden Dome Ecosystem Hub gains a living, breathing "Digital Twin" of the U.S. defense industrial base. If a critical component vendor is hit by malware, Cyberspatial visualizes the blast radius of that attack across the entire missile shield network instantly.
